当前位置: 首页 > news >正文

用Python实现第一个量子机器学习模型完整教程:Qiskit与TensorFlow集成

——手把手代码教学与常见问题解决方案

作者:DREAMVFIA UNION
发布日期:2026年2月1日
版权:© 2026 DREAMVFIA UNION

--------------------------------------------------

目录

1. 第一章:引言——为什么学习量子机器学习

2. 第二章:量子计算基础回顾

3. 第三章:环境搭建与工具准备

4. 第四章:第一个量子机器学习模型

5. 第五章:Qiskit与TensorFlow深度集成

6. 第六章:常见问题与调试技巧

7. 第七章:性能优化与最佳实践

8. 总结与展望

第一章:引言——为什么学习量子机器学习

量子机器学习(Quantum Machine Learning,QML)代表了人工智能与量子计算两大前沿领域的交汇点。随着量子计算硬件的快速发展和经典机器学习算法逐渐触及性能瓶颈,量子机器学习被认为是最有可能率先实现"量子优势"的应用领域之一。本教程将带领读者从零开始,使用Python实现第一个量子机器学习模型,掌握Qiskit与TensorFlow的集成方法,并学会解决实际开发中遇到的常见问题。

量子机器学习的核心思想是利用量子计算的独特特性——如量子叠加、量子纠缠和量子并行——来加速或增强经典机器学习算法的性能。研究表明,在特定任务上,量子机器学习算法相比经典算法可能实现指数级的加速。随着IBM、Google、IonQ等公司不断推出更强大的量子计算机,学习量子机器学习技术正当时。

第二章:量子计算基础回顾

2.1 量子比特与量子态

量子比特(Qubit)是量子计算的基本单位,与经典比特的0或1不同,量子比特可以处于|0⟩和|1⟩的叠加态。一个量子比特的状态可以用波函数表示为:

|ψ⟩ = α|0⟩ + β|1⟩

其中α和β是复数系数,满足归一化条件|α|² + |β|² = 1。这个公式表明,一个量子比特可以同时处于多个状态的叠加,这是量子计算强大能力的来源。

2.2 量子门操作

量子门是对量子比特进行操作的基本单元,类似于经典逻辑门。常见的单量子比特门包括:

量子门

矩阵表示

功能描述

Hadamard (H)

1/√2 [[1,1],[1,-1]]

创建叠加态

Pauli-X

[[0,1],[1,0]]

量子非门

Pauli-Y

[[0,-i],[i,0]]

Y轴旋转

Pauli-Z

[[1,0],[0,-1]]

Z轴旋转


Figure 1: Basic Quantum Circuit Structure and Fundamentals

第三章:环境搭建与工具准备

在开始量子机器学习之前,我们需要搭建合适的开发环境。本教程主要使用以下工具:

http://www.jsqmd.com/news/330971/

相关文章:

  • 04课程:10、11通过yum安装Nginx~12简单源码安装和yum安装的区别~13通过Nginx源码复杂安装
  • Github源码推荐 | Prometheus:让自主无人机开发更简单、更高效!
  • 2026年 热熔胶厂家推荐排行榜:热熔胶颗粒/热熔胶块/压敏胶/聚烯烃热熔胶/聚酰胺热熔胶/EVA热熔胶/滤清器热熔胶/快递袋热熔胶/包装热熔胶/标签热熔胶,专业粘合解决方案
  • 新域名 oierin.top
  • 实用指南:Ubuntu 虚拟机配置静态 IP
  • 仿真引擎——构建系统跳动的心脏
  • 基于ssm+vue+mysql的爱心商城系统(源码+部署调试+大文档+讲解)
  • 2026年 云南旅行社推荐榜单:诚信地接+包车导游服务,火车站附近接送机一站式解决方案
  • 系统自动触发的登出逻辑*
  • 2026年 台湾物流专线服务商推荐排行榜:台湾专线物流/整柜运输/清关派送/电商物流/小三通物流/大件物流/海运运输,高效稳定跨境解决方案
  • U654615 比特聚集(bit)补题报告
  • 虚拟机需要连外网,同时笔记本连接wlan,IP经常变,该怎么配置网络?
  • 计算机毕业设计 | SpringBoot+vue高校迎新系统 新生报道高校宣传招生平台(附源码)
  • QTCreator error: C3861: “_mm_loadu_si64”: 找不到标识符
  • java: lambda表达式(极简解释)(自用)
  • 实用指南:RabbitMQ 在拼团系统中的应用:延迟队列、订单超时与消息幂等
  • SpringBoot基础配置拓展配置类+拦截器
  • VS2015安装后,安装QT59,之后安装qt-vsaddin-msvc2015-2.4.3.vsix 文件失败问题!
  • 2026年 精馏塔/蒸馏塔/回收设备厂家推荐榜单:NMP、DMF、DMAC专业精馏回用与蒸发设备技术实力深度解析
  • 零基础博客园皮肤美化攻略 - LI,Yi
  • 可撤销并查集,可持久化并查集
  • 金融时间序列预测全流程框架:从SHAP特征选择到智能算法优化深度学习预测模型,核心三章实验已完成,尚未发表,期待有缘人!
  • 输入旅游目的地,自动查询当地风俗禁忌,物价参考,反诈提醒,生成境外/外地出行安全指南。
  • 详细介绍:goldenLayout布局
  • 03.课程:06.Nginx的官方简介~
  • 04
  • 全文查AI率降AI率完整教程:从45%降到8%的实战方法
  • Eclipse 关闭项目详解
  • Google 地图叠加层:功能、应用与未来展望
  • 美团二面挂了!问 “用户积分系统怎么设计”,我答 “加个字段存总数”,面试官:积分过期你怎么算?